The “Pressure Cooker” Effect: Physics of a Storm

When high winds hit your garage door, they exert thousands of pounds of pressure against the panels. This pressure is transferred directly to the tracks, rollers, and most importantly, the steel aircraft cables that hold the door’s tension.

  • The Weak Link: A healthy cable is designed to withstand this load. However, a cable with even a few frayed strands (often called “brooming”) has lost up to 70% of its structural strength.
  • The Catastrophe: If a cable snaps under wind load, the door will kick out of its track, often buckling in the middle. Once the garage door fails, the wind enters the garage, creating internal pressure that can actually lift the roof of your home.

3 Signs Your Cables are a Storm Risk

You shouldn’t wait for a thunderstorm to inspect your system. Look for these visual “red flags” that indicate you need immediate garage door repair Central Florida:

  1. The “Orange Dust” (Rust): Because garage floors stay damp, the bottom of the cable near the bracket often rusts. If you see orange flakes or discoloration, the steel is corroding from the inside out.
  2. Loose Spools: When the door is closed, the cables should be tight like guitar strings. If you see slack or the cable is jumping off the drum at the top, your tension is dangerously uneven.
  3. Frayed “Hair”: Run a (gloved) hand near the cable. If you see tiny silver hairs sticking out, the individual strands of the aircraft cable are snapping. This is a “ticking time bomb” that will fail under the next heavy wind gust.
